Sharon moves back into Jack’s flat. But Dennis is unhappy, in spite of Sharon’s efforts. He asks her why no one ever stays. Shirley taunts Phil about Sharon leaving. Left alone at Tanya’s, Sharon cuts her finger on a glass and raids Tanya’s cupboard for a plaster. She spots a pack of painkillers, takes one and steals a blister pack.

Kat brings over some of Tommy’s old toys for Scarlett. Michael offers her dinner – Alice will cook. Kat warns him not to take Alice for granted. From Max, Michael learns that Jack has gone away, and asks how he’ll run the gym alone. Kat’s goes to Michael’s and is sitting with Scarlett when the doorbell goes. Michael answers to the back of a head. She turns round, ‘Hello Michael’. It’s Janine.

Alice wants a new hairstyle and Poppy twigs that it must be for a man, unaware it’s Michael. Poppy advises Alice not to give her man everything. They discuss the signs of love and how Alice should proceed. When Michael buys Alice perfume, Alice misinterprets the gift and makes her move on Michael, following Poppy’s advice. She’s mortified when Michael rebuffs her advances. Michael explains to Alice that she’s too young, too good.

Kirsty tells Max she wants to go alone to the abortion clinic. She tells Kat that Max is taking her. But when Max arrives at the Vic, Kat tells him that Kirsty would never want to go through an abortion alone. Tanya is frustrated that Max hasn’t told her about Kirsty’s baby, despite plenty of opportunity. Later, Sharon comes over with wine for a girly chat. Tanya makes her excuses and goes to Max’s office, confronting him about the baby.

Ian suggests they re-mortgage the house to fund the restaurant. Lucy’s furious. Shirley teases Denise about Ian. Show less
